Former Canadian National passenger depotr in downtown Owen Sound, ON.
The depot was built in 1932, and saw passenger service until 1970. It was used as a freight depot for a time before the line was abandoned.
It currently holds the Community Waterfront Heritage Centre (CWHC)-run Marine and Rail Museum.
